Creamy Cookies Font: Adding Whimsy to Web Design

I was staring at a blank hero section for a boutique skincare brand last Tuesday, feeling that familiar design block. The layout was clean, the photography was ethereal, and the color palette was perfectly muted, but something was missing. The standard sans serif headings felt too corporate, and the typical elegant serifs felt too serious for a brand that wanted to emphasize self-care and joy. That is when I decided to test Creamy Cookies, a handwritten marker font from Script Amp, to see if it could bridge the gap between professional polish and playful personality.

As web designers and digital creators, we often hesitate to use script fonts in functional interfaces. There is a lingering fear that decorative typography will sacrifice readability or slow down the user’s scanning behavior. However, modern web design is shifting toward more expressive, human-centric aesthetics. After integrating Creamy Cookies into this real-world project, I discovered that this typeface offers a unique solution for brands needing warmth without losing digital clarity. It is not just a novelty font; it is a strategic design asset when applied with intention.

First Impressions in the Hero Section

The first place I tested Creamy Cookies was the main headline: "Glow with Gentle Care." On my 27-inch monitor, the playful strokes and delightful curves immediately softened the entire page. Unlike rigid geometric display fonts, this typeface has a natural bounce that mimics actual handwriting. The letters connect fluidly but maintain enough separation to remain legible at larger sizes. This is crucial for web headers where users need to grasp the value proposition in milliseconds.

What stood out during this initial test was the font's inherent texture. In an era of flat design and AI-generated perfection, Creamy Cookies feels authentically human. The marker-style edges add a tactile quality that pairs exceptionally well with organic product photography. For the skincare site, this visual cue reinforced the brand promise of natural ingredients before the user even read the body copy. It established an emotional connection through typography alone, turning a static landing page into an inviting digital experience.

Balancing Personality with Readability

A beautiful font is useless if users cannot read it. When moving from desktop to mobile preview mode, I had to be vigilant. Handwritten fonts can sometimes become illegible on smaller screens due to intricate details or tight spacing. With Creamy Cookies, I found that it performs best when given ample breathing room. I increased the line-height slightly and avoided using it for sentences longer than five words. This restraint preserved the whimsy while ensuring accessibility.

For the mobile layout, I reserved Creamy Cookies strictly for primary headlines and accent phrases. Subheadings and navigation elements remained in a clean, neutral sans serif. This contrast is essential for visual hierarchy. By limiting the script font to high-impact areas, I prevented cognitive overload. Users could scan the page structure effortlessly while still enjoying the decorative moments. This approach proves that you do not have to choose between brand personality and user experience; you simply need to manage the dosage.

Strategic Font Pairing for Digital Brands

Creamy Cookies shines brightest when it has a supporting actor. During the design process, I paired it with a modern geometric sans serif for body text and UI elements like buttons and forms. The stark contrast between the organic, flowing script and the structured, rational body copy created a dynamic tension that felt both creative and trustworthy. This pairing strategy is vital for e-commerce sites where conversion depends on clarity.

This combination works particularly well for coaching websites, portfolio homepages, and course sales pages. In these contexts, the creator’s personality is the product. The script font acts as a digital signature, reinforcing the idea that there is a real person behind the screen. Meanwhile, the structured supporting typography assures visitors that the business is organized, professional, and reliable.

Application Across Different Web Elements

Beyond the hero section, I explored how Creamy Cookies could enhance other parts of the digital ecosystem. On the shop page, I used it sparingly for category labels like "Best Sellers" and "New Arrivals." This subtle application added a layer of curation and care that standard uppercase tracking could not achieve. It made the shopping experience feel less like a transaction and more like a personal recommendation.

For blog graphics and social media templates derived from the site, the font proved incredibly versatile. Because it retains its character even when scaled down for Instagram stories or Pinterest pins, it helps maintain brand consistency across channels. However, I always advise checking contrast ratios when placing this font over images. The marker texture can sometimes get lost against busy backgrounds. Using a solid color overlay or a text shadow is often necessary to meet WCAG accessibility standards while keeping the aesthetic intact.

Technical Considerations for Web Implementation

Before committing Creamy Cookies to a live project, practical technical checks are non-negotiable. As a premium font from Script Amp, verifying the licensing is the first step. Ensure your license covers web embedding, especially if you are designing for a client or an online store with commercial intent. Desktop licenses do not always include webfont usage, so reviewing the terms prevents legal headaches down the road.

Performance is another key factor. Decorative fonts can sometimes have larger file sizes due to complex glyph data. I recommend using WOFF2 formats and implementing font-display: swap in your CSS. This ensures that text remains visible during loading, preventing invisible text flashes that hurt SEO and user experience. Additionally, check for OpenType features. Creamy Cookies includes alternates and ligatures that can elevate the design. Accessing these stylistic sets allows you to customize specific letter connections, making the typography feel bespoke rather than repetitive.

When to Choose Whimsy Over Tradition

Not every project needs a handwritten marker font. If I were designing a fintech dashboard or a medical portal, Creamy Cookies would likely undermine the necessary sense of security and precision. However, for lifestyle brands, creative agencies, bakeries, florists, and personal blogs, this typeface is a powerful tool. It signals approachability and creativity in a way that traditional typography cannot.

In my skincare project, the decision to use Creamy Cookies transformed the site from a generic template into a distinct brand identity. It solved the problem of sterility without introducing chaos. For web designers and UI creators looking to add a sprinkle of charm to their layouts, this font offers a balanced blend of artistic expression and digital functionality. It reminds us that even in the structured world of grids and pixels, there is always room for a little bit of handmade magic.

Ultimately, successful web typography is about serving the user while expressing the brand. Creamy Cookies succeeds because it respects the boundaries of digital readability while pushing the aesthetic envelope. Whether you are refreshing a portfolio, launching a new product line, or rebranding a coaching business, testing this typeface might be the exact creative spark your next project needs. Just remember to pair it wisely, test it rigorously on mobile, and let its whimsical nature enhance, rather than overshadow, your content strategy.
